To set color in fabric using vinegar and salt, mix 1 part vinegar, 1 part salt, and 16 parts water in a container. Soak the fabric in this solution for an hour, then rinse it thoroughly with cold water. This method helps to lock in the color and prevent fading.
To mix nectar to 3 parts water, you would combine 1 part nectar with 3 parts water. For example, if you have 1 cup of nectar, you would mix it with 3 cups of water to achieve the 1:3 ratio. Stir well to ensure thorough mixing.
